Ukraine's Armed Forces keep holding the frontline, inflicting continuous damage to Russian troops. A new General Staff report says 950 Russian servicemen were killed and wounded over the past day alone.

The total combat Russian losses from February 24, 2022, to March 6, 2026, are estimated to be:

  • Personnel — approximately 1,271,350 (+950);
  • Tanks — 11,734 (+7);
  • Armored combat vehicles — 24,148 (+6);
  • Artillery systems — 37,960 (+45);
  • Multiple-launch rocket systems — 1,669 (+2);
  • Air defense systems — 1,320 (+1);
  • Aircraft — 435;
  • Helicopters — 349 (+1);
  • Operational-tactical UAVs — 159,990 (+1,609);
  • Cruise missiles — 4,384;
  • Ships/boats — 30;
  • Submarines — 2;
  • Automotive equipment and fuel tanks — 81,642 (+208);
  • Special equipment — 4,080 (+1).

Frontline situation

Ukraine's military struck several logistics facilities and concentrations of Russian troops recently. Among other targets, a ground-based repeater of the command post for Geran/Gerbera-type strike drones was hit in temporarily occupied Crimea.

Besides, Special Operations Forces of the Armed Forces of Ukraine carried out a series of successful raids on Russian army supply facilities in Crimea and Donbas. Air defense systems and three fuel depots were targeted.

Moreover, on March 5, the Ukrainian Navy destroyed a Russian Ka-27 helicopter over the Black Sea.
